Minnesota Timberwolves

Minnesota left no chance for Memphis (109:101). However, before that, the Timberwolves had suffered three defeats in a row, losing away to Charlotte (108:110) and Washington (127:142), as well as to Golden State (114:137) at home. With 11 wins and 11 losses, Minnesota is ninth in the Western Conference standings. To help the team due to injury, Karl-Anthony Towns will not be able to start the play. The rest of the team leaders are healthy and ready to take part in the match.

Oklahoma City Thunder

Oklahoma City beat San Antonio at home (119:111) in the last match. However, before that, they lost in two matches in a row, losing on the road to Houston (105:118) and New Orleans (101:105). The Thunder, with nine wins and 13 losses, is in 13th place in the West. Oklahoma as a whole is approaching the match with a fighting lineup.
